Output 6121a7f6312858631d731e2fe163b6ce3adcc1350a8a3fe35edefce07b35f03d:8

value
540468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f83d6c100e3cb03db54e7fec8ca4b594a61cb987 OP_EQUAL
address
3QKb5oSCodY3uzkzbh4k8rZFvvCe2jJzWU
transaction
6121a7f6312858631d731e2fe163b6ce3adcc1350a8a3fe35edefce07b35f03d
spent
true